Job description

About the role

As Spear expands its reach across the North, our Northern Development Coach will focus on two things: equipping young people facing barriers to employment with the confidence, mindset and skills to move into sustainable work, and developing the coaches around you to do the same.

To do this, you will work across Spear Centres throughout the region - delivering coaching sessions directly with 16–24-year-olds as well as supporting and upskilling Spear Centre teams

Key information:

  • Salary: from £27,000
  • Full-time, 12-14 month Fixed Term Contract, with the possibility of extension
  • 28 days annual leave (including Christmas gift days) plus bank holidays (pro rata)
  • Closing date: We interview on a rolling basis and will close the role early if we find the right candidate

For more information please read through our Job Specification and Work with Us Pack.

If you require any reasonable adjustments as part of the recruitment process, please let us know.

Person Specifiction

  • A practising Christian, passionate about personally representing the values and beliefs of Spear, and our mission to equip and support young people facing barriers to employment
  • Demonstrable experience as a coach, or a background in youth work or teaching, and are keen to develop these skills further
  • A heart for young people and releasing their potential, no matter what challenging circumstances they are facing
  • Effective interpersonal skills and high emotional intelligence with a sense of humour and fun
  • Exercises initiative, highly self-motivated, flexible and a forward planner
  • Good administrative and organisational skills, and prioritises workload effectively
  • Works well under pressure with the ability to exercise initiative
